Understanding Electric Vehicle Battery Technology

Electric vehicle power click here source systems is quickly changing, and grasping the fundamentals is increasingly important for buyers. Most current EVs rely on lithium-ion batteries, which function by moving ions between a positive and a anode electrode. Several compositions exist within the lithium-ion family, each delivering a unique mix of energy density, power, reliability, and cost.

  • NMC batteries offer a balanced trade-off
  • LFP cells are known for their reliability and longevity
  • LCO batteries usually provide maximum energy density but exhibit safety risks
Continuous research is focused on improving battery performance through innovations in engineering and cell design, with goals encompassing increased range and reduced charging times while lowering prices.

State Incentives for Electric Car Purchase

To stimulate the move to zero-emission transportation, several public organizations are offering financial support for electric auto purchasers . These rebates can encompass immediate financial rebates , sales deductions , or lower registration fees . The particular amount of the benefit and requirement standards vary considerably depending on the location and the type of EV car that is purchased .
